❄️ ABSOLUTE ZERO

A deterministic agentic OS for LLMs. Zero dependencies. Zero vendor lock-in. Zero forgotten lessons.

ABSOLUTE ZERO is a personal engineering brain built as an Obsidian vault plus 14 stdlib-only Python engines. The LLM (Claude, GPT, anything with a shell) is the CPU; the scripts are the syscalls; markdown is the memory. Every task is classified, planned, context-packed within a token budget, routed to the best tool, executed, mechanically verified, and harvested for lessons — so the same mistake is never paid for twice.

The bet: you don't need a proprietary model to outperform SOTA coding agents. You need better orchestration around whichever model you have.

Why it exists

LLM sessions are amnesiac. Context windows are budgets, not warehouses. Agent frameworks are dependency towers that rot. ABSOLUTE ZERO answers all three with one design:

  • Memory is markdown — human-readable, git-versioned, greppable forever.
  • Intelligence is swappable — every engine is a plain CLI with JSON output; any model on any machine can drive it.
  • Nothing is trusted — an 11-check verifier gates every change; a state machine rejects illegal workflow transitions loudly; failures become ledger entries that future tasks are forced to see.

The engines

Engine Script What it does
Orchestrator orchestrator.py Classifies every request (intent × complexity), issues a strategy pipeline, enforces the state machine trace
Context context.py Builds the Optimal Context Package: pinned spine, scored ranking, fidelity tiers, dedup, budget ceiling, OMITTED tail
Planner planner.py Decomposes into subtasks, per-intent step templates with risk/test/rollback, topological order, validation gates
Verifier verifier.py 11 checks (ast analysis, vault law, security patterns, real selftest execution) → gated verdict; FAIL exits 1
Plugins plugins.py Discovers every tool, scores by coverage/reliability/latency, greedy set-covers a chain + fallbacks, learns from outcomes
Prompt compiler promptc.py Composes LAW > TASK > INSTRUCTIONS > TOOLS > CONTEXT > EXAMPLES > VERIFY > OUTPUT under budget pressure
Skills skills.py Discovers which skills to load, resolves conflicts/subsumption, phase-orders the chain
Experience experience.py Harvests closed traces into draft lessons, fault entries, workflow stats, duplicate-code alerts, pattern counts
Agents agents.py 8-role multi-agent runtime: dynamic DAG per request, parallel scheduling, CAS blackboard, message bus
Graph graph.py Typed knowledge graph (8 node / 7 edge types) over code, notes, skills; BFS, shortest path, semantic search
Bootstrap bootstrap.py Onboards any repo in one command: language, frameworks, architecture, risks, conventions, context package
Indexer indexer.py Frontmatter → INDEX.json, INDEX_SUMMARY.md, FAULT_LEDGER.md
Query query.py Pull-based retrieval by tags/type/project/date
Review review.py Orphan + stale note detection

All engines: stdlib only, cross-platform (pathlib), self-tested (--selftest is law — 14/14), fail loud (P1).

Quick start

git clone https://github.com/Vishnu-3727/ABSOLUTE-ZERO.git
cd ABSOLUTE-ZERO
cp scripts/hooks/pre-commit .git/hooks/   # commit gate: verifier must pass

python scripts/indexer.py                 # build the index
python scripts/orchestrator.py plan "fix the date crash in review.py"
python scripts/context.py pack "odometry drift on takeoff" --project ASUNAMA
python scripts/verifier.py check          # gate your changes
python scripts/dashboard.py               # render the ICE dashboard (HTML)

# health check: every engine proves itself
for s in scripts/*.py; do python "$s" --selftest; done

Requires Python 3.11+. No pip install. Ever. (That's a law — the verifier rejects non-stdlib imports.)

The workflow

/wake  → briefing from CLAUDE.md + ACTIVE_GOALS + INDEX_SUMMARY (≈800 tokens)
/task  → orchestrator trace: RECALL → PLAN → EXECUTE → VERIFY → SUMMARIZE
          (VERIFY fail → retry EXECUTE, max 2, enforced by the state machine)
/recall → query.py + graph.py, citations or "not in vault" — never invented
/sleep → session log, experience harvest, reindex, graph rebuild, commit

Command contracts live in FLOW.md; the constitution is CLAUDE.md; each engine has a one-page spec at the vault root (ORCHESTRATOR.md, CONTEXT.md, …).

Vault anatomy

00_CORE/        identity, active goals, principles (grown via /review)
10_PROJECTS/    per-project OVERVIEW / DECISIONS / FAULTS / SESSIONS
20_KNOWLEDGE/   topic notes
30_LESSONS/     transferable lessons (auto-drafted from failed verifies)
40_RESEARCH/    sourced research notes
90_META/        INDEX.json, FAULT_LEDGER, traces, plans, runs, dashboard.html
scripts/        the 14 engines

Every note carries YAML frontmatter with a mandatory ≤25-token summary — that's what makes budget-priced retrieval possible.

Design laws

  1. Stdlib only. Dependencies are future breakage.
  2. Fail loud. Silent fallbacks cost sessions (learned the hard way — see the fault ledger).
  3. Budget is a ceiling, not a quota. Low-relevance context stays out even with room left.
  4. Vault facts only. Claims carry file-path citations or "not in vault".
  5. Every script carries its own proof. --selftest or it doesn't merge.
  6. Artifacts are committed, never indexed. Work memory ≠ knowledge memory.
